一种视觉跟踪方法和跟踪装置与流程

文档序号:12670832阅读:来源:国知局

技术特征:

1.一种视觉跟踪方法,包括:

获取眼部图案;

建立眼部对象关键点;

利用眼部对象关键点作为对象处理方法的测试数据处理眼部图案,确定眼部对象位置,形成视觉焦点数据。

2.如权利要求1所述的视觉跟踪方法,还包括:

将眼部对象的连续变化,形成视觉跟踪数据;

将视觉跟踪数据作为控制信号用于虚拟视觉的动作变化。

3.如权利要求2所述的视觉跟踪方法,其特征在于,所述获取眼部图案包括:

获取脸部的五官轮廓;

根据眼部特征点裁剪出对称的眼部图像。

4.如权利要求2所述的视觉跟踪方法,其特征在于,所述建立眼部对象关键点包括:

利用半人工或自动的方式建立眼部对象;

利用半人工或自动的方式形成眼部对象的关键点。

5.如权利要求2所述的视觉跟踪方法,其特征在于,所述利用眼部对象关键点作为对象处理方法的测试数据处理眼部图案,确定眼部对象位置,形成视觉焦点数据包括:

将眼部图案的像素数据导入ERT算法作为训练数据进行处理;

将确定的眼部对象及眼部对象关键点作为测试数据修正ERT算法的处理结果;

根据修正的处理结果形成眼部对象的准确轮廓和准确的相对位置关系。

6.如权利要求2所述的视觉跟踪方法,其特征在于,所述将眼部对象的连续变化,形成视觉跟踪数据包括:

在实时获取的眼部图案中,根据眼部对象的相对位置变化形成视觉跟踪数据;

在实时获取的眼部图案中,根据眼部对象的相应关键点的相对位置变化形成视觉跟踪数据。

7.如权利要求2所述的视觉跟踪方法,其特征在于,所述将视觉跟踪数据作为控制信号用于虚拟视觉的动作变化包括:

建立眼部对象和/或眼部对象的关键点,与眼部三维模型或二维模型中的对象和对象的关键点的映射,形成虚拟视觉焦点;

利用视觉跟踪数据控制眼部三维模型或二维模型中的对象和/或对象的关键点的移动,形成虚拟视觉的变化。

8.一种视觉跟踪装置,包括:

图像获取模块,用于获取眼部图案;

关键数据建立模块,用于建立眼部对象关键点;

对象识别模块,用于利用眼部对象关键点作为对象处理方法的测试数据处理眼部图案,确定虹膜位置,形成视觉焦点数据。

9.如权利要求8所述的视觉跟踪装置,其特征在于还包括:

视觉跟踪数据生成模块,用于将眼部对象的连续变化,形成视觉跟踪数据;

虚拟视觉控制模块,用于将视觉跟踪数据作为控制信号用于虚拟视觉的动作变化。

10.如权利要求9所述的视觉跟踪装置,其特征在于,所述图像获取模块包括:

轮廓获取子模块,用于获取脸部的五官轮廓;

图像裁剪子模块,用于根据眼部特征点裁剪出对称的眼部图像。

11.如权利要求9所述的视觉跟踪装置,其特征在于,所述关键数据建立模块包括:

眼部对象建立子模块,用于利用半人工或自动的方式建立眼部对象;

对象关键点建立子模块,用于利用半人工或自动的方式形成眼部对象的关键点。

12.如权利要求9所述的视觉跟踪装置,其特征在于,所述对象识别模块包括:

图像导入子模块,用于将眼部图案的像素数据导入ERT算法作为训练数据进行处理;

图像处理子模块,用于将确定的眼部对象及眼部对象关键点作为测试数据修正ERT算法的处理结果;

眼部对象位置生成子模块,用于根据修正的处理结果形成眼部对象的准确轮廓和准确的相对位置关系。

13.如权利要求9所述的视觉跟踪装置,其特征在于,所述视觉跟踪数据生成模块包括:

眼部对象轨迹生成子模块,用于在实时获取的眼部图案中,根据眼部对象的相对位置变化形成视觉跟踪数据;

对象关键点轨迹生成子模块,用于在实时获取的眼部图案中,根据眼部对象的相应关键点的相对位置变化形成视觉跟踪数据。

14.如权利要求9所述的视觉跟踪装置,其特征在于,所述虚拟视觉控制模块包括:

虚拟焦点生成子模块,用于建立眼部对象和/或眼部对象的关键点,与眼部三维模型或二维模型中的对象和对象的关键点的映射,形成虚拟视觉焦点;

虚拟视觉生成子模块,用于利用视觉跟踪数据控制眼部三维模型或二维模型中的对象和/或对象的关键点的移动,形成虚拟视觉的变化。

当前第2页1 2 3 
网友询问留言 已有0条留言
  • 还没有人留言评论。精彩留言会获得点赞!
1